The Warehouse Attendant receives stores and distributes material tools equipment and products. This is a union position.

This role will pay an hourly wage of $14.20 to 17.75 (per the CBA)

Benefits are per the union agreement.

Responsibilities

  • Unload incoming deliveries per quality work instructions.
  • Opens boxes and other containers using company approved hand tools i.e. company issued box cutters.
  • Convey product and items from receiving areas to storage (i.e. coolers shelves etc. or to other designated areas by hand pallet jack or other.
  • Sort and place product or items on racks shelves coolers or bins according to predetermined sequence such as date of expiration size type or product code.
  • Fill requisitions work orders or request for product or other stock items and distribute in a timely manner per work instructions.
  • Assemble orders from stock and places orders on pallets or shelves.
  • Verify quantities record amount of product or items received or distributed and shortages and damages.
  • Keep warehouse/product storage areas in order.
  • Unload incoming deliveries per quality work instructions and verifies against packing slip.
  • Maintain consistent communication with Purchasing Department Director Managers and Lead regarding new items change of brand names change of location count incoming shipments etc.
  • Uses proper and safe methods when operating all warehouse equipment i.e. pallet jacks.
  • Notify manager of out of stocks.
  • Follow directions from Managers/Warehouse Lead
  • Performs other related duties as assigned by supervisor.

Qualifications

  • Must have a High School Diploma/GED
  • Must have sufficient math ability to accurately add subtract divide multiply and perform other basic business math calculations.
  • Must speak be able to read and understand English well enough to converse with customers supervisors and employees.
  • Understand written and oral direction and communicate effectively with others.
  • Two 2 years warehouse experience with previous electric pallet jack experience.
  • Must possess good organizational skills.
  • Must have ability to follow directions and effectively perform the work.
  • Ability to work closely with others.
  • Must be able to work in a fastpaced environment sense of urgency.
  • Must have a pleasant personality and adhere to Uniform Standards policy.
  • Must be able to work various shifts and hours to include holidays and weekends.
  • Ability to take tasks that are not clearly defined and appropriately define problem propose and implement solutions.
